**Persistent El Niño conditions have suppressed Atlantic tropical cyclone development throughout the 2026 season, driving the near-certain market-implied odds against two or more U.S. hurricane landfalls.** As of September 10, the basin has produced only five named storms—all tropical storms with maximum sustained winds below hurricane strength (64 knots)—and zero hurricanes, according to National Hurricane Center summaries. Three of those systems (Arthur, Bertha, and Edouard) made U.S. Gulf Coast landfalls as tropical storms. Official NOAA outlooks issued in August project a below-normal season overall, with a 75% probability of below-average activity and ranges centered on just 2–6 hurricanes for the full year, citing continued El Niño-driven wind shear and atmospheric stability that inhibit organization and intensification. With the climatological peak now passing and no hurricanes formed to date, the Accumulated Cyclone Energy stands at roughly 4% of the long-term median. Remaining activity is expected to stay limited, keeping the probability of even one U.S. hurricane landfall low and the chance of two or more extremely remote. While late-season surprises remain possible if steering patterns or shear relax unexpectedly, current model consensus and observational data support the strong trader consensus reflected in the 98.8% implied probability for “No.”

A hurricane is a tropical cyclone with maximum sustained winds of 74 mph or greater (Category 1 or higher on the Saffir-Simpson Hurricane Wind Scale), as described at https://www.nhc.noaa.gov/aboutsshws.php, and a hurricane landfall is said to occur when the hurricane's surface center intersects with the coastline, as described at https://www.nhc.noaa.gov/aboutgloss.shtml#LANDFALL. A storm must hold hurricane strength (Category 1 or higher on the Saffir-Simpson scale) at the moment its surface center intersects the coastline for that landfall to qualify.
If a single storm makes landfall more than once within this area during this period, each landfall identified as a distinct landfall by the NHC is counted separately toward the total. A storm that briefly moves over open water and returns to make an additional landfall counts as a separate landfall only if the NHC's own reporting identifies it as such; a single continuous track that does not leave and re-strike land counts once.
This market may resolve based on the initial NHC advisory reporting a qualifying landfall regardless of any later advisory, retraction, best-track revision, or reanalysis that revises that storm's intensity downward at the time of landfall. However, if a subsequent advisory or correction identifies a qualifying landfall that was not reflected in initial reporting, that landfall will be added to the count.
